git 操作規範

2021-08-19 07:21:27 字數 2316 閱讀 5878

git checkout master

git checkout -b dev

git branch dev

git checkout dev

git

branch

git branch -a

git add a

.html

git commit -m "提交檔案a.html"

git checkout master

git merge dev

git

branch -d dev

git

branch

master建立新分支:

git checkout master

git checkout -b issues1234

gitpush origin issues1234

gitadd ..

git commit -m "***"

gitpush origin issues1234

git push origin branch1:branch2

git branch -d   issues1234  //本地強制刪除分支issues1234

git push origin :issues1234 //推到遠端

<<<<<<< head

creating a new branch is quick & ******.

*****==

creating a new branch is quick and ******.

>>>>>>> feature1

git status

git add

***git commit -m "fix conflict"

git push origin 分支名

git stash

git stash pop //恢復的同時把stash內容刪掉

或者//恢復stash,但是stash內容並不刪除

git stash drop

//在上面操作的基礎上,以此來刪除stash

注: git stash list

//檢視全部的stash列表

git stash clear

git reset

--hard head

git reset

--hard 版本號

git reflog

git  checkout -- a

.html

①: 還沒有執行 git add

操作,執行上面的操作後,會恢復到和版本庫中一模一樣的版本狀態。

②: 執行了git add

,還沒執行 git commit ,再執行上面的操作後,會恢復到git add 結束後的狀態

git clean -f ../aa.html

git clean -df ./demo

git reset

--hard 版本號 //本地回退到指定的版本

git push  -f origin dev    //將遠端的也回退到指定版本
git fetch origin -p

//用來清除已經沒有遠端資訊的分支,這樣git branch -a 就不會拉取遠端已經刪除的分支了

git fetch -p

git remote show

origin

git操作規範

分支命名規範 開發新功能 feature device,feat device 測試階段bug bugfix device 線上階段bug hotfix device 假如當前在master分支上 git commit m 第一版儲存內容 返回內容分別表示內容 分支 版本號 commit資訊 mas...

git 如何返回上一步操作 git 操作規範

git 操作規範 一 建立與合併分支 1 從master分支建立dev分支並切換到dev分支 git checkout master git checkout b dev 其中,git checkout b dev 等價於 git branch dev git checkout dev 1 git ...

Git 提交規範

無規矩不成方圓,程式設計也一樣。乙個commit只做一件事情,若乙個commit做了多件事情需要拆分成多個commit 嚴格遵循commit message格式 每次只允許提交乙個commit,若本地有多個commit等待提交,必須等前面的commit合併進入主版本庫並在本地合併完成後才可提交後面的...